To clarify, why 4Gb is not a good idea for RAM. XP does not let you allocate more than a bit over 3 Gb RAM.
Vista lets you allocate more.

NVidia 9800GT (or whatever abbreviation) is working well for me. I have Vista and have 4 gigs of memory.
Actually, the total allocation is about 3,336MB - so going to 4 Gigs allows you to max out and take advantage of that extra 264MBs of RAM (4 Gigs = 4,096MB, 3 Gigs = 3,072MB, 3,336 - 3,072 = 264).
